概括
再循环的体具有与新体相比较的粘合强度,尽管两者在热循环后都会降解. 回收过程会改变表面粗度,但不会改变构成或晶体相位.

背景情况:
- 将废弃物转化为合金块是牙科中一个有希望的可持续方法.
- 然而,与新生合金相比,回收合金的粘合性能需要进行彻底的研究.
研究的目的:
- 为了评估复合树脂与循环的结合亲和力和耐久性,在体外.
- 为了比较回收的性能与商用的性能.
主要方法:
- 循环回收的石块与商业石一起加工和烧结.
- 标本经过抛光,空气中的颗粒磨损,并与树脂水泥结合.
- 切割键强度 (SBS) 在0,10,000和30,000个热循环后进行了测试.
主要成果:
- 在回收和商业基组之间没有观察到SBS的显著差异.
- 热循环在两组中都显著降低了SBS.
- 再循环的显示表面粗度增加 (Ra,Rz,Rq),但结晶相和元素组成相似.
结论:
- 商业石的粘合协议对回收石有效.
- 在热循环后,回收和商业的粘合强度都会下降.
- 回收会改变表面的地形,而不会影响基本的材料性能.

Bonding and Strength of Aggregate
146
The bond between aggregate particles and the cement matrix is significantly influenced by the shape and surface texture of the aggregates. High-strength concretes benefit from a rougher texture, which leads to stronger bonding due to greater adhesion. Angular aggregates with larger surface areas also enhance this bond. Brick durability, strength, and appearance are crucial factors in construction, influencing the choice of bricks for specific applications. The process of freeze-thaw, for instance, significantly affects brick durability. This phenomenon occurs when water absorbed by a brick expands as it freezes, potentially causing damage when it melts and refreezes.
